Greasy Fork镜像 还支持 简体中文。

Kleinanzeigen Mietdashboard V8.2 (Final Anchor Fix)

Dashboard mit präzisem Anker, robustere Parser, €/m², Werbeblocker #komplett refaktoriert

< 腳本Kleinanzeigen Mietdashboard V8.2 (Final Anchor Fix)的回應

評論:負評 - 腳本失效或無法使用

§
發表於:2025-08-21

Leider funktioniert das Script in der hochgeladenen Version nicht (mehr), da Kleinanzeigen die m² nicht mehr in den Tags, sondern in einer Zeile darüber anzeigt.

Mit folgendem Fix geht es wieder:

Zeile 86-89 können komplett weg (Schönheitsfehler)

Zeile 159 ändern von:

const tagsContainer = item.querySelector('p.aditem-main--middle--tags');

auf

const tagsContainer = item.querySelector('.aditem-main--bottom p');

Zeile 162 und 163 ändern von:

const simpleTags = tagsContainer.querySelectorAll('span.simpletag');
simpleTags.forEach(tag => { if (tag.textContent && tag.textContent.includes('m²')) areaText = tag.textContent; });

auf

if (tagsContainer.innerHTML.includes('m²')) { areaText = tagsContainer.innerHTML; };
§
發表於:2025-08-21
編輯:2025-08-21

Außerdem ist die m²-Preiskalkulation verkehrt, wenn der Preis rabattiert wurde. Daher noch ein Fix:

Zeile 158 ändern von:

const priceText = priceElement ? priceElement.textContent : null;

auf

const priceText = priceElement ? priceElement.textContent.match(/([\d\.,]+) €/i)[1] : null;

發表回覆

登入以回覆

QingJ © 2025

镜像随时可能失效,请加Q群300939539或关注我们的公众号极客氢云获取最新地址